TURN-208: Gatevale turnstile counters at the Merrow Field pilot double-count when a rotation reverses mid-cycle. Attendance totals drift roughly 2% high per event. The debounce window fix is implemented, reviewed by Ilsa, and soak-tested across two simulated match days without drift. Ready for your cut; the candidate build is identified below.

trace token, tagag-tafog: htk6_5ed18c

Subject: Quickstore 4.2 — bloom filter now fronts the KV layer

Plugin authors: starting with this release, Quickstore places a bloom filter ahead of the key-value store. Negative lookups return faster; false positives fall through safely. No API changes are required on your side. Verify your plugin against the staging build referenced below.

session token of fahif-tadup = htk3_9c7

**Mgmt Meeting Minutes — Retiring the Brightline Range**

Quick recap for sales leads at Fenholt Supplies: we agreed to retire the Brightline fixture range by year-end. Remaining stock moves to clearance pricing next month, and accounts on standing orders get migrated to the Lumetta range. Trade-in incentives were approved in principle. The confidential note on next steps sits just below.

board note of bajof-bajeg: The pricing group signed off on a budget of $13.4 million for Project Sildor. The renewal with Lamixek Holdings closes at $48.9 million a year, 49 percent above the last contract.

## Authentication

The Vertica Lift dispatch simulator requires authentication for all calls to the internal simulation gateway, including car-state reads and queue injection. Contractors receive a scoped key valid for the sandbox environment only; production access is handled separately by the platform team at Dunmore. Keys expire after 60 days and requests with expired keys return a 403 with a rotation hint. For local development against the sandbox gateway, use the key below.

app token of bahaf-tajeg = zpat23_SjjsllwiLmXbtS65veZaV47